新闻动态
新闻动态
- 柳州的债务,谁来还?用什么还?怎么还?
- 小米 AI 眼镜发布,售价 1999 元起,有哪些功能亮点?你看好其市场前景吗?
- 如何看待暴露但很还原的cos?
- 为什么抖音上的姑娘都那么好看,现实中我怎么一个也见不着?
- 你见过最沉着住气的人是什么样子?
- 如何评价Electron?
- 如果苹果真的下架了微信的话,会发生什么?
- go-zero的svc全局变量和Kratos按需利用wire进行依赖注入哪个在实际生产合作中更合适?
- 2025年六月现在硬盘咋还涨价了呢?
- 和女生合租,都会发生什么事情?
联系我们
邮箱:youweb@qq.com
手机:13988888888
电话:020-88888888
地址:广东省广州市番禺经济开发区
公司动态
nodejs 真的不擅长CPU密集型计算么,与c++或者 rust 差别有多大?
作者:admin 发布时间:2025-06-28 16:45:11 点击:
首先要明白 Node.js 不适合 CPU 密集型的本质,是没有一个简单的方法把计算过程也多线程化。
Node.js 中 IO 任务是天然多线程的,也就是所谓的异步非阻塞 IO,所以效率很高,当你开启一个 IO 任务的时候,程序可以继续做其他事。
但如果你要做的是一个又臭又长的计算任务,那自始至终都只有一个线程。
这就很炸裂了。
Node.js里也存在 Worker Threads、Cluster之类的方法可以让你手动迁移计算任务,但都不是很方便,以及开销过大…。
新闻资讯
-
2025-06-28 17:05:11除了厚重,你拒绝折叠屏的理由还有哪些?什么样的折叠屏才能打动你?
-
2025-06-28 17:15:11通义千问推出多模态统一理解与生成模型 Qwen VLo,图像生成效果如何?有哪些信息值得关注?
-
2025-06-28 18:00:11柳州的债务,谁来还?用什么还?怎么还?
-
2025-06-28 18:00:11有什么是你去河南才明白的事?
-
2025-06-28 17:30:11豆包推出 AI 编程,在「编辑模式」下可以直接前端改图和文字,体验如何?对行业会带来怎样的影响?
-
2025-06-28 18:45:11女生穿牛仔裙好看吗?
相关产品
